Grill difference  is easy just the weight  really.

Masuri vs Ayrtek has been discussed  many time here and it really depends  on the person. I went from ayrtek to masuri elite to masuri  original. Some swear by ayrtek some by masuri.

You can't  go wrong with a masuri in my opinion. The new series is heavy but fits well and better air flow  I went back to original because  the grill was affecting  my vision but others have not had this problem.

I only used ayrtek for a couple of nets and just couldn't  get the fit right I also found it too heavy but again others dont have this issue.

That makes sense... but do you really feel the weight difference on your head ?
Having used both  steel and titanium on masuri, I don't  think you will see much difference  once on. It is more in the head, both  ayrtek and vision series are heavy helmets so even with titanium you are going to feel the weight. The level of protection  you need should be considered as well but comfort is paramount  in my humble  opinion.
